Subject: Fan-out checks for Gustline alerts

Hey Pallora crew,

Quick heads-up for the security review: our Gustline weather-alert fan-out now shards by region, so your webhook receivers may see bursts of up to 500 events per second during storm spikes. Retries back off exponentially and dedupe on event ID, so you shouldn't see doubles. Can you confirm your queue depth alarms are tuned for that? Also, rotate anything older than 30 days on your side. To hit the sandbox fan-out endpoint, authenticate with this.

portal login ticket: eyJhbGciOiJIUzI1NiIsInR5cCI6IkpXVCJ9.eyJzdWIiOiIwEOsktwVNwIn0.-UJU3fdyyCgG

**Ticket: Flaky DNS resolution in Glimmerhook plugin sandbox**

Hey plugin folks — some of you have reported that calls from the Glimmerhook sandbox intermittently fail with NXDOMAIN on the first request, then work fine on retry. Looks like our resolver pool in the Tarnwick cluster sometimes hands out a stale entry before the TTL refresh lands. We're shipping a patched resolver this week. To help us correlate failures, check your logs against the trace token below.

pipeline stamp: htk6_c0ef30

Handing off the Quillbus broker upgrade (4.x to 5.1) to Dario. Cluster is half-migrated; mixed-version mode is supported but TLS cert rotation must finish before cutover. No auth model changes, though the admin API gained two new endpoints worth reviewing. Open questions and the migration checklist are tracked on the internal page below.

dashboard of taduf-bawef = https://jira.lumicsys.internal/projects/display/browse/b1cbf89d